Transaction 6278517892fd465e95a5063a8488cece2c61ea39823787554273f80496a86f26

1 Input
2 Outputs
  • 6278517892fd465e95a5063a8488cece2c61ea39823787554273f80496a86f26:0
  • value  1056480
    address  1LR3HVqC1PJ6ie1R8xjuh5Fva1Y3XEueiS
  • 6278517892fd465e95a5063a8488cece2c61ea39823787554273f80496a86f26:1
  • value  440364
    address  1J3xDHHREsMk549JEBZf9iZyirKtw7VnFM